SYTRAC: An Edge AI-Based Intelligent Traffic Signal Control System Using OPC UA and Deep Learning for Smart City Applications

Urban traffic congestion is a primary driver of greenhouse gas emissions, wasted fuel, and degraded air quality, presenting a significant barrier to achieving sustainable cities (SDG 11) and climate action (SDG 13). Standard Adaptive Traffic Signal Control (ATSC) systems are either financially prohibitive for developing countries or lack certified safety mechanisms for physical deployment on live roads. This paper proposes and validates SYTRAC (System for Adaptive Traffic Control), a low-cost, safety-critical Adaptive Traffic Signal Control system designed for resource-constrained urban environments. SYTRAC implements an asynchronous co-design that combines real-time visual vehicle detection on an NVIDIA Jetson Nano GPU with deterministic safety execution on a Siemens S7-1200 Programmable Logic Controller (PLC). The core of the system is the Density-Weighted Adaptive Green Extension (DWAGE) algorithm. DWAGE provides a stable, interpretable, and computationally lightweight alternative to complex optimization methods such as genetic algorithms, particle swarm optimization, or Deep Reinforcement Learning. We establish a formal mathematical queue-stability guarantee using a closed-form Foster–Lyapunov drift argument. A three-mode fault-tolerant state machine with a 2 s watchdog automatically transitions to fixed-time fallback in the event of hardware or camera stream failures, protecting physical intersection safety. The system was validated through hardware-in-the-loop field deployments at a live intersection in Ouargla, Algeria. SYTRAC achieved a statistically significant 22.1% reduction in average vehicle delay (p<0.001), while microscopic simulations confirmed up to 28.0% delay suppression during lane-blockage incidents. Critically, this delay reduction translates to an environmental saving of 53.5–72 kg of CO2 avoided per day, alongside annual fuel savings of 8430 L. Assembled within a $1257 hardware budget, SYTRAC delivers a cost-effective, open-source, and reproducible platform that bridges the gap between adaptive intelligence and industrial safety, providing a scalable blueprint for sustainable urban traffic management in emerging economies.
